Abstract

Gene Expression Programming (GEP) is an orginal and an effective searching method. Multiple Linear Regression (MLR), Artificial Neural Network (ANN) and GEP techniques were used to investigate the correlation between retention indices (RI) and descriptors for 91 oxygen-containing organic compounds. The correlation coefficient on OV-1 column is 0.9891(for ANN), 0.9919(for GEP), and 0.9911(for MLR), on SE-54 column is 0.9892(for ANN), 0.9955(for GEP), and 0.9917(for MLR). As shown from the results, the predicted values by GEP and the experimental values are in good agreement, Also, the QSRR model by GEP is better than QSRR models by ANN and MLR methods.
